Light earthquake, 4.3 mag strikes near Jurm in Afghanistan


Earthquake location 36.6214S, 70.9355WA light earthquake with magnitude 4.3 (ml/mb) was detected on Thursday, 28 kilometers (17 miles) from Jurm in Afghanistan. The temblor was picked up at 03:08:20 / 3:08 am (local time epicenter). Unique identifier: us7000pmym. Ids that are associated to the event: us7000pmym. Global time and date of event 27/03/25 / 2025-03-27 03:08:20 / March 27, 2025 @ 3:08 am UTC/GMT. The earthquake occurred at a depth of 201.129 km (125 miles). A tsunami warning has not been issued (Does not indicate if a tsunami actually did or will exist). Exact location, longitude 70.9355° East, latitude 36.6214° North, depth = 201.129 km.

Nearest cities/city/villages to epicentrum/hypocenter was Fayzabad, Ishqoshim, Ashkāsham (min 5000 pop). Epicenter of the event was 63 km (39 miles) from Fayzabad (c. 44 400 pop), 62 km (38 miles) from Ishqoshim (c. 26 000 pop), 54 km (33 miles) from Ashkāsham (c. 12 100 pop), 29 km (18 miles) from Jurm (c. 12 100 pop). Country/countries that might be effected, Afghanistan (c. 29 121 000 pop), Tajikistan (c. 7 487 000 pop).

Earthquakes 4.0 to 5.0 are often felt, but only causes minor damage. In the past 24 hours, there have been one, in the last 10 days five, in the past 30 days seven and in the last 365 days one hundred and fourty-one earthquakes of magnitude 3.0 or greater that was reported nearby. There are an estimated 13,000 light quakes in the world each year.
